1. If the foundation system is given a vertical load of 400 kN and a moment of 40 kN m. calculate the safety factor for the foundation system. (Hint: calculate load distribution at the base of the foundation) and If the required design criteria is SF 3.0, does the foundation system still meet the requirements? If not, what is your suggestion to meet the design criteria?
